The complete new world translation published in english, spanish, and italian braille ranges from 18 to 28 volumes and requires a minimum of two meters 6 ft 5 in of shelf space other formats require less room than a bible on embossed paper. The book of eli is a 2010 american postapocalyptic neowestern action film directed by the hughes brothers, written by gary whitta, and starring denzel washington, gary oldman, mila kunis, ray stevenson, and jennifer beals. This book of bible stories made especially for families with either a blind child or a blind parent is just like any other, complete with pictures, except that a clear sheet of plastic with braille on it has been inserted between the pages so that the stories can be read either in braille or in print.
